Tension springs, unlike their coiled counterparts, operate on the principle of stored energy. They are typically made from thin, flexible wire, often stainless steel, wound into a tight coil. When stretched or compressed, they resist the change in shape and store energy within the material. This stored energy is then released when the spring returns to its original form, providing the force required for the desired action.

While tiny tension springs may seem insignificant, their quality has a direct impact on the overall performance and reliability of the products they are used in. Springs made from low-grade materials or with improper manufacturing techniques can lead to premature failure, resulting in product malfunction or even safety concerns. Conversely, high-quality springs provide a longer service life, ensure smooth operation, and contribute to a positive user experience.
